Wow, Apple made a two-button mouse… Kind of. Sort of. I’m confused. This new mouse offers the functionality of a two-button mouse, along with some kind of special “squeeze the sides” feature that effectively works like a third button. All in a mouse that looks like it has zero buttons.
The whole reason Apple didn’t come out with a two-button mouse was that they felt the second button would confuse users. So, they’ve “solved” this by providing the same functionality, but with no affordance as to where the two buttons actually are?
I know Apple loves clean design, but Logitech solved the “two buttons but no buttons” problem much more elegantly than by making the buttons completely invisible.
I’ll bet that for a frequent, experienced user, this mouse will be greatly productivity-enhancing — once you get used to it. But Apple technology used to be incredibly easy to use for beginners because of clean design, not in spite of it. There is absolutely no justifiable reason for not delineating the separate button regions, aside from Apple’s design aesthetic, which is diverging more and more from the “form follows function” ideal as time goes on.
